Lionel 48W Station With Whistle 1937-42

Lionel put a whistle into the little lithographed sheet metal station in 1937 and numbered it the 48W. The station was originally sold in green litho with a transformer in it with the Winner line.

The 48W allowed kids with trains that didn’t have whistles to add whistles to their layouts. This was a cheaper option than buying an extra tender with a whistle.
The box for this station is rarer than the item itself. The box is just flimsy cardboard and didn’t survive.
